Facsimile Editions
In the realm of sophisticated publications of limited edition rare books,
the facsimiles are by now the unquestionable peak of greater artistic
and scientific prestige. By reproducing with the utmost accuracy every
detail of the original work (paper, binding, colour, the gold leaves of
miniatures and even every kind of stain) the facsimiles enable bibliophiles
and scholars to consult, study, admire works which are unique and hardly
accessible, kept away in libraries and seldom available for consultation
because of conservation problems.
Furthermore the facsimile books are accompanied by critical editions entrusted
to the major specialists who explain the history and contents of the early
works. The exclusive value of these extraordinary gems in rare book productions
is enhanced by their de luxe containers, and by the fact that they are
in a limited edition.
